Tidewater Renewables Ltd. released Q4 results on March 9, reporting that its renewable diesel project collocated with its Prince George refinery in British Columbia is 90 complete and expected to begin commissioning late in the first quarter.
Aemetis Inc. released Q4 results on March 9, reporting full year revenues were up 21 percent when compared to 2021. During an earnings call, company officials discussed ongoing projects related to ethanol, RNG and SAF production.
Legislation currently pending in Minnesota aims to establish a clean transportation standard that would require the state's transportation fuels to achieve 100 percent reduction in carbon intensity (CI) by 2050.
The assets of Cedar Road Bioenergy Inc., located in Nanaimo on Vancouver Island, British Columbia, are being offered for sale via an online auction that ends March 21. The landfil gas-to-energy facility opened in 2009 and opeated through 2020.
Greenlane Renewables Inc. has been awarded a $7.2 million (US$5.4 million) contract through Synthica St Bernard LLC for a food waste to pipeline renewable natural gas (RNG) project in Ohio.
The USDA on March 8 kicked off the inaugural National Biobased Products Day and highlighted the accomplishments of people and organizations working to improve sustainability within the federal government.
On the inaugural National Biobased Products Day, the Agriculture Energy Coalition released a letter to Senate and House Agriculture Committee leaders urging them to preserve funding for Farm Bill energy title programs.
Marathon Petroleum Corp. on March 8 announced it has acquired a 49.9 percent interest in LF Bioenergy, an emerging producer of renewable natural gas (RNG) in the U.S., from Cresta Fund Management for $50 million.
The U.S. Energy Information Administration released its latest Short-Term Energy Outlook on March 7, predicting that renewables will account for 24 percent of U.S. electricity generation this year, expanding to 26 percent in 2024.
The Washington State Senate on March 1 voted 46 to 2 in favor of a bill that aims to encourage the manufacture and purchase of SAF though tax incentives. The bill also directs WSU to convene a workgroup to further development of alternative jet fuel.
The U.S Department of Energy's Bioenergy Technologies Office and the National Renewable Energy Laboratory are launching the next phase of the organic Waste-to-Energy Technical Assistance for Local Governments.
Divert Inc. has announced a $1 billion infrastructure development agreement with Enbridge Inc. The agreement will support the development of wasted food to renewable natural gas (RNG) facilities across North America.
Viridi Energy has begun construction on a landfill renewable natural gas (RNG) project at the Marathon County Solid Waste Department's landfill in Ringle, Wisconsin. The project will convert a dormant biogas-to-energy project into an RNG facility.
Anaergia Inc. on Feb. 22 announced it has sold its Envo Biogas plant in Tønder, Denmark to Copenhagen Infrastructure Partners' Advanced Bioenergy Fund I, which is developing biogas projects in Europe and North America.
Beyond6 will build a state-of-the-art renewable compressed natural gas facility to supply for Detmar Logistics LLC. When complete in Q3, the station will deliver CNG linked to renewable natural gas (RNG).
Aemetis Inc. on Feb. 13 released an updated five-year plan that provides insights into the company's plans to generate $2.0 billion of revenues, $496 million of net income, and $682 million adjusted EBITDA in year 2027.
FPU Renewables LLC on Feb. 21 announced plans to construct, own and operate a dairy manure renewable natural gas (RNG) facility at Full Circle Dairy in Madison County, Florida. The project is expected to be operational in 2024.
Aemetis Inc. in Feburary hosted California Department of Food and Agriculture Secretary Karen Ross for a discussion and site tours of the company's renewable biofuel and dairy-based renewable natural gas (RNG) facilities.
Shell Petroleum NV, a wholly owned subsidiary of Shell plc, has completed the acquisition of 100 percent of the shares of Nature Energy Biogas A/S, the largest producer of renewable natural gas (RNG) in Europe.
Green Impact Partners Inc. in mid-February announced plans to purchase all of the partnership units of GreenGas Colorado LLC held by its minority partner and announced the selection of Amber Infrastructure Group as a strategic partner.
Amp Americas has begun construction on a dairy renewable natural gas (RNG) project in Darlington, Wisconsin. The new project is expected to capture dairy waste from approximately 4,000 cows and is scheduled begin operations in mid-2023.
The U.S. Government Accountability Office on Feb. 9 issued a determination that states the U.S. EPA's June 2022 denial of 69 SREs under the RFS is not a rule, and therefore is not subject to the requirements of the Congressional Review Act.
The U.S. EPA on Feb. 16 released data showing that two SRE petitions have been filed under the RFS over the past month. A total of 24 SRE petitions are now pending, up from 22 that were pending as of mid-January.
The U.S. EPA has released data showing more than 1.75 billion renewable identification number (RINs) were generated under the Renewable Fuel Standard in January, up from 1.59 billion that were generated during the same month of 2022.
UGI Energy Services LLC, a subsidiary of UGI Corp., and Archaea Energy Inc., a subsidiary of bp, have entered into a joint venture, Aurum Renewables LLC, to develop a renewable natural gas (RNG) project in Pennsylvania.
The American Biogas Council submitted comments to the U.S. EPA's proposed “Set Rule� regarding the Renewable Fuel Standard. The proposed rule includes RVOs for 2023, 2024 and 2025 and addresses the genration of eRINs.
Goldman Sachs Asset Management, through its infrastructure investing business has established Verdalia Bioenergy, a new business focused on developing, acquiring, building and operating biomethane plants across Europe.
CAM Integrated Solutions LLC announced on Feb. 2 their partnership with Amp Americas, a leader in the renewable natural gas (RNG) industry providing carbon-negative fuels and feedstocks from waste at dairy farms.
The U.S. Department of Energy on Jan. 30 awarded $131 million for 33 carbon management projects. At least four of the funded projects specifically address carbon capture related to bioenergy and biofuels.
H.I.G. Capital has announced that its portfolio company, Northern Biogas LLC, has acquired three additional dairy renewable natural gas (RNG) projects, significantly expanding its RNG production capacity.
